首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

由javac编译的非必要导入

是指在Java代码中使用javac编译器进行编译时,出现的一种警告信息。它表示在代码中存在一些不必要的导入语句,即导入了未被使用的类或包。

非必要导入可能会导致以下问题:

  1. 增加了代码的冗余性,使代码变得难以维护和理解。
  2. 增加了编译时间,因为编译器需要处理多余的导入语句。
  3. 可能会引入命名冲突的问题,当导入了多个类具有相同名称的情况下。

为了避免非必要导入的问题,我们应该进行以下操作:

  1. 删除未被使用的导入语句,以减少代码冗余。
  2. 仅导入需要使用的类或包,以避免命名冲突和提高代码的可读性。
  3. 使用IDE(集成开发环境)的自动优化导入功能,可以自动删除未被使用的导入语句。

对于Java开发者来说,了解和遵循良好的编码规范是非常重要的。在编写代码时,应该尽量避免非必要导入,以保持代码的简洁性和可维护性。

腾讯云相关产品和产品介绍链接地址: 腾讯云开发者平台:https://cloud.tencent.com/developer 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ai 腾讯云物联网(IoT):https://cloud.tencent.com/product/iot 腾讯云区块链(BCS):https://cloud.tencent.com/product/bcs 腾讯云元宇宙(Metaverse):https://cloud.tencent.com/product/metaverse

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券